关于cpwordpress的信息

如何在Centos7上全新安装WordPress程序

1.数据库部署

创新互联公司坚持“要么做到,要么别承诺”的工作理念,服务领域包括:网站设计、成都网站制作、企业官网、英文网站、手机端网站、网站推广等服务,满足客户于互联网时代的邱县网站设计、移动媒体设计的需求,帮助企业找到有效的互联网解决方案。努力成为您成熟可靠的网络建设合作伙伴!

为Wordpress程序创建用户名为360readuser,密码为360readpsd的数据库。

登陆数据库:mysql -uroot -p

创建数据库:CREATE DATABASE 360read;

创建数据库用户:CREATE USER 360readuser@localhost IDENTIFIED BY '360readpsd';

给用户所有权限:GRANT ALL PRIVILEGES ON 360read.* TO 360readuser@localhost;

刷新生效: FLUSH PRIVILEGES;

退出:exit

重启服务:systemctl restart mariadb.service

systemctl restart httpd.service

2.安装的WordPress

1建立一个临时文件夹,下载最新版本的Wordpress3.92,中英文都可以。

mkdir /tmp/wp

cd /tmp/wp

wget

解压缩到网站根目录: unzip -q latest.zip -d /var/www/html/

2更改wordpree文件夹属主:chown -R apache:apache /var/www/html/wordpress

更改wordpress文件夹权限:chmod -R 755 /var/www/html/wordpress

创建一个可以上传的目录upload,并将属主改为apache:

mkdir -p /var/www/html/wordpress/wp-content/uploads

chown -R :apache /var/www/html/wordpress/wp-content/uploads

3修改配置文件,以便可以访问数据库

cd /var/www/html/wordpress/

cp wp-config-sample.php wp-config.php

vim wp-config.php 修改红色字体部分:

define('DB_NAME', '360read');

define('DB_USER', '360readuser');

define('DB_PASSWORD', '360readpsd'); 修改完成后 :wq !

4浏览器输入 后就可以进行最后的登陆安装,输入站点名称,登陆户名,密码,邮箱就可以完成Wordpress安装!

如果出现如下错误:Your PHP installation appears to be missing the MySQL extension which is require

可能是PHP-mysql模块丢失造成的,重新yum install php-mysql ,并且重启mariadb和httpd服务就可以了。

5开启支持网站固定链接修改和重定向功能。

编辑主配置文件:vi /etc/httpd/conf/httpd.conf

...AllowOverride None 修改为AllowOverride All...

然后重启服务:systemctl restart httpd.service

创建.htaccess文件:touch /var/www/html/wordpress/.htaccess

编辑:vim /var/www/html/wordpress/.htaccess,加入以下内容,也可以让网站自动生成。

IfModule mod_rewrite.c

RewriteEngine On

RewriteBase /wordpress/

RewriteRule ^index\.php$ - [L]

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ule . /wordpress/index.php [L]

/IfModule

修改.htaccess文件权限:chmod 664 /var/www/html/wordpress/.htaccess,修改为664可以让网站支持自动更新,也可以修改为644。

至此,Wordpress在Centos7上已经完全安装了,可以用它搭建你想要的任意网站了。

wordpress伪静态保存不了

确保Web目录权限是否正确,并给予apache对相关文件夹的权限

chown -R apache:apache /var/www/html/

chmod -R 755 /var/www/html/

mkdir -p /var/www/html/wp-content/uploads

chown -R :apache /var/www/html/wp-content/uploads

二、宝塔面板里的设置

1)登录到宝塔面板,点击左侧网站,找到网站点右侧的设置链接

2)选择左侧"伪静态",输入如下代码:

location /

{

try_files $uri $uri/ /index.php?$args;

}

rewrite /wp-admin$ $scheme://$host$uri/ permanent;

修改完后保存即可。

付:Wordpress安装 :centos 7 搭建wordpress 网站详细教程 - 简书

wget //下载最新版wordpress

解压文件,并且将其复制到/var/www/html目录下

#解压文件

unzip -q latest.zip

#复制 wordpress文件夹下所有文件到html目录下

cp -rf wordpress/* /var/www/html/

#修改文件夹权限

赋予apache对相关文件夹的权限

修改文件夹权限

chown -R apache:apache /var/www/html/

chmod -R 755 /var/www/html/

mkdir -p /var/www/html/wp-content/uploads

chown -R :apache /var/www/html/wp-content/uploads

编辑WordPress配置文件

编辑配置文件

cd /var/www/html

cp wp-config-sample.php wp-config.php

vim wp-config.php

找到define(‘DB_NAME’, ‘wordpressdb’);

将 wordpressdb 修改为你创建的wordpress数据库名

找到define(‘DB_USER’, ‘wordpressuser’);

将 wordpressuser 修改为你创建的数据库用户名

找到define(‘DB_PASSWORD’, ‘123456’);

将 123456 修改你创建数据库用户的密码

输入:wq!保存

重启相关服务

systemctl restart httpd.service

systemctl restart mysqld.service

systemctl start mysqld.service

systemctl stop mysqld.service

进入Web页面设置

访问http://你的域名/wp-admin

wordpress怎样搭建网站

Wordpress 是 PHP 和 MySQL 结合的内容管理系统。

可以搭建很多类型网站:

个人博客

WordPress 最早的定位就是个人博客,可以很轻松的放上内容,进行分享内容。

企业网站

因为 WordPress 的安全性,很多人就用来搭建企业网站,毕竟很多功能都可以通过插件来实现,搭建起来就很轻松。朗沃教育的官网就是。

BBS论坛--社交网络

创建自己的社交网站就像在WordPress中设置BuddyPress这样的插件一样简单。

购买型网站

使用WordPress的一种常用方法是创建一个在线商店。

WordPress使创建一个在线商店变得非常容易。得益于WooCommerce这样的插件

创办视频网站

可以使用WooCommerce HTML5视频插件将视频添加到的在线商店产品描述中。

基本上所有的网站都可以用 WordPress 来搭建,很多功能都可以通过插件来实现。

Wordpress 最大的优点就是开源、插件多,很多功能都可以通过插件实现。

这既是 WordPress 的后台。

朗沃教育 - WordPress 搭建的网站后台

cp的免费空间 使用WordPress /无法更新/

是空间限制了许多功能的缘故,已经发现许多空间存在着问题。

有问题的有:主机屋,freehostia,kilu.de,godaddy。当然,我说的这些是免费空间的。在这些里面,GD的表现最好,但无法邮件发日志,不能不能是遗憾。


网页名称:关于cpwordpress的信息
文章源于:http://pwwzsj.com/article/dopicis.html